First privately printed edition of Frank Gray Griswold's tribute to the Canadian salmon. Octavo, original wrappers as issued, full color illustration of the "Griswold Gray" lure affixed to front panel. Singed by the author on the half-title page, "Frank Gray Griswold." In very good condition.
American author and sportsman Frank Gray Griswold authored dozens of books with a particular focus on salmon fishing, many printed privately and distributed among his personal friends. In Salmo Salar, Griswold takes an academic approach to the study of the declining salmon population throughout the rivers of North America.
